Sheen Talks One-on-One With Williams in His Only Daytime Interview

Airing September 19 on 'The Wendy Williams Show'

LOS ANGELES, Sept. 12, 2011 -- Debmar-Mercury's "The Wendy Williams Show" has landed an exclusive interview with film and TV star Charlie Sheen that will air on September 19, 2011. It is Sheen's only scheduled interview with a daytime talk show, and this is Sheen's first appearance on "The Wendy Williams Show."

"I am beyond excited and I can not wait to talk to Charlie," said Williams. "He's easily the hottest topic of the year and I'm thrilled that fans of 'The Wendy Williams Show' will be the first to see and hear everything that's going on in his life, in his own words."

Few stars have dominated headlines and captured the public's attention more than Charlie Sheen. From tabloid coverage of his private life, to his dramatic exit from hit television series "Two and a Half Men," to his explosive media interviews, audiences are fascinated by Sheen and now Wendy Williams will ask the questions that everyone wants the answers to on "The Wendy Williams Show."

The third season of "The Wendy Williams Show" premieres today, September 12, with a visit from reality star Kate Gosselin. Sheen is only the latest star planning to visit "The Wendy Williams Show" in what is a sizzling September. More of today's hottest stars visiting this month include Antonio Banderas (September 28), Roseanne Barr (September 21), Michael Bolton (September 14) and Jane Lynch (September 22).
